A New Algorithm Based on the Improved Transient Chaotic Neural Network for Cellular Channel Assignment

Abstract:

In this paper,the Transient Chaotic Neural Network(TCNN)is used to solve the Channel Assignment Problem(CAP),and a new method named two-stage annealing method in TCNN is proposed.The neural network gradually convergences,through the transient chaos,to a stable eqnilibrium point according to the damping of the self-feedback connection weight,and the dividing point in the new model is chosen according to the change of the corresponding Lyapunov exponent.The two-stage annealing method can make sure the network take good advantage of the chaos to search the global minimum and enhance the convergence rate.In the 7-cell cellular network,the convergence rate is 30% higher than the TCNN model,and is also upgraded 15% in the Kunz's benchmark test.Simulated results show that the new model has a higher searching ability and lower computing time in searching the global minimum.The searching ability and the choosing of the parameters are also discussed based on the simulated results.
